mgb:

If you haven't already, from the command prompt, type mame -createconfig.

This will create the mame.ini file in your mame folder.
Click on that to open in word. Look for where it says bezels, it will have a 1. Just change that to a 0 and save and close

BadMouth:


--- Quote from: Pakled on January 23, 2013, 11:01:19 am ---Once I do that how do I get Maximus Arcade to load the .ini file?

--- End quote ---

You don't.  The .ini file controls what MAME displays and how it is displayed.
If you aren't getting the desired results, either you haven't changed the correct option in the mame.ini file or
there is a .ini file for that particular game in the ini folder (in your MAME folder) that is over-riding mame.ini

Maximus Arcade is irrelevant. 
MAME is launched by Maximus Arcade the same way it's always been.
